
This is a unique vintage liquor cabinet disguised as a set of four faux Shakespeare books in a wooden case. Inside, it holds an amber glass decanter with diamond pattern and five matching shot glasses. The set also includes two gold-tone liquor labels marked “Rye”, “Bourbon”, “Gin” and “Scotch”. Wooden book-style cabinet with 4 faux Shakespeare volumes approx. 11″ tall × 9″ wide. Decorative brass face emblem on top. Amber glass decanter with stopper approx. Five matching amber shot glasses approx. 2.5 tall each. Two gold-tone 2 side liquor labels with chains (“Rye”, “Bourbon”, “Gin” and “Scotch”). Condition: Vintage, overall very good with minor wear consistent with age. This bar set is both functional and decorative, perfect for collectors of mid-century barware or unique home décor.
